Front panel LEDs and buttons

Item

Description

Status

1

UID LED/button

Blue = Identification is activated.
Flashing blue = System is being managed remotely.
Off = Identification is deactivated.

2

Health LED

Green = System health is normal.
Amber = System health is degraded. To identify the component in a
degraded state, see "HP Systems Insight Display and LEDs ("

HP

Systems Insight Display LEDs

" on page

13

)".

Red = System health is critical. To identify the component in a critical
state, see "HP Systems Insight Display and LEDs ("

HP Systems Insight

Display LEDs

" on page

13

)".

Off = System health is normal (when in standby mode).

3

NIC 1 link/activity LED

Green = Network link exists.

Flashing green = Network link and activity exist.
Off = No link to network exists.
If power is off, the front panel LED is not active. For status, view the

RJ-45 connector LEDs.

4

NIC 2 link/activity LED

Green = Network link exists.

Flashing green = Network link and activity exist.
Off = No link to network exists.
If power is off, the front panel LED is not active. For status, view the

RJ-45 connector LEDs.

5

Power On/Standby button
and system power LED

Green = System is on.
Amber = System is in standby, but power is still applied.

Off = Power cord is not attached, power supply failure has occurred,
no power supplies are installed, facility power is not available, or the
power button cable is disconnected.
